LiNbO3surface‐acoustic‐wave edge‐bonded transducers on ST quartz and ⟨001⟩ cut GaAs

摘要:

LiNbO3surface‐acoustic‐wave edge‐bonded transducers have been fabricated on ST quartz and ⟨001⟩ cut GaAs substrates. Efficient transduction has been demonstrated with fractional bandwidths of 50 and 91% for the ST quartz and GaAs substrates, respectively. The devices have a center frequency in the vicinity of 100 MHz. Conversion loss as low as 4 dB has been measured. A model which accurately predicts this transducer performance has been devised.
